Marrakech has become an essential luxury destination for the Parisian elite, with its legendary riads, five-star resorts, and vibrant souks drawing a constant stream of private jet traffic from Le Bourget.
The overwhelmingly one-way southbound pattern creates reliable repositioning opportunities. After delivering passengers to the Red City, aircraft must return to their European home bases, offering empty leg savings of 45-60%. Midsize jets such as the Citation Latitude and Challenger 350 are the standard for this route, providing the range for the overwater crossing and the cabin comfort for the three-hour journey.
Marrakech's appeal spans all seasons, giving this route unusually broad availability. Winter offers ideal weather for those escaping the grey Parisian skies, while spring and autumn provide pleasant conditions for exploring the medina and Atlas Mountains. French school holidays -- Toussaint, Christmas, February break, and Easter -- create pronounced demand spikes. Events such as the Marrakech International Film Festival and the 1-54 Contemporary African Art Fair add further momentum. Do I need a visa for Morocco?+
EU and US citizens do not need a visa for stays up to 90 days. A valid passport with 6 months validity is required.
What is the customs process for private jets in Marrakech?+
The private aviation terminal at Menara Airport handles customs and immigration on-site with dedicated VIP processing, typically under 20 minutes.
Is this route available during Ramadan?+
Yes, though demand patterns may shift slightly. Morocco remains open to tourists during Ramadan, and charter traffic continues.
